    Then you should be using Reader! It is in the address bar when you are in an article and it basically just cuts out all the crap and puts the article into a nice well formatted and easier to read space with no ads. Also benefits from putting the article onto one space instead of it being broken up into 5 pages (looking at you EG!).

    *Split keyboard on iPad is cool.
    *Tabbed browser is iPad only. (only switched to Atomic Web and iChromy for tabs now I can switch back)
    *Newsstand is a neat idea but I will never use it.
    *Notification Center, they ripped off someones else's idea and will now call it their own.
    *iMessage is basically WhatsApp as it works the same. (ripped off the idea, again - but now Apple invented it)
    *Twitter crap means nothing to me as I dont tweet.
    *PC Free, wireless syncing the iPad/iPhone syncs automatically when its plugged into a dock or power lead, well one would assume if iTunes is open on the PC that is.
    *Built in dictionary for all apps which support it.
    *AirPlay Mirroring for iPad 2 (only iPad 2 feature I can see) + you need Apple TV v2.


    Looks like there are no iPad2 specific updates other than the one above so iPad1 users will get it all too.


    My iPhone 3GS already has the new App Store well the way it shows old purchased downloads is their now.
